    They had a winch line slung over the opposite limb and hooked to the one he was cutting hoping cause it to be pulled away from what ever was below and to lower it safely to the ground. A slight miscalculation in the strength of the limb versus the build up of kinetic energy from the falling weight of the cut off limb very nearly ended in total disaster for the guy, aside from having a strong safety strap, dropping his chain saw may have been the smartest thing he had done to that point and that was involuntary I am sure
